The startup develops a handheld nanotechnology device that identifies unique genetic sequences in biological samples for the diagnosis of cancer, infectious diseases, and genetic disorders. This technology enables healthcare professionals to deliver targeted treatments based on precise genetic information, enhancing patient care and diagnostic accuracy.

Problem
Current methods for diagnosing cancer, infectious diseases, and genetic disorders often involve complex laboratory procedures and lengthy turnaround times. This can delay treatment decisions and increase patient anxiety.
Solution
The startup is developing a portable, handheld nanotechnology device designed for rapid identification of specific genetic sequences within biological samples. This point-of-care diagnostic tool aims to provide healthcare professionals with immediate access to critical genetic information, enabling faster and more informed treatment strategies. By streamlining the diagnostic process, the device seeks to improve patient outcomes through timely and targeted interventions. The technology has the potential to reduce the reliance on centralized labs, making genetic testing more accessible in diverse healthcare settings.

Features
- Nanopore-based sequencing technology for direct analysis of genetic material
- Handheld form factor for point-of-care testing
- Real-time data analysis and result reporting
- Compatibility with various biological sample types
- Integrated software for data management and interpretation
